Arashi holds a special live in affected areas! Also experience harvesting and firefighting training!
Quote:
The five members of Arashi held a mini live in the areas affected by the Great East Japan Earthquake back in May, specifically in Ofunato City in Iwate Prefecture. This would be the first time all 5 members visit Iwate Prefecture since the earthquake, and the complete footage will be introduced during the 12-hours special program "THE MUSIC DAY Ongaku no Chikara" (NTV/10:30AM) on July 6th.
Before their performance, all five of them walked through the affected areas to experience their current situation, in addition to make contact with some of the victims. Sakurai Sho (31), Ohno Satoshi (32) and Aiba Masaki (30) visited Minato Village at night. During the story of this disaster, most families at the time engaged in harvesting/fishing tangle in order to contribute to the reconstruction, all 3 members shed sweat while actually fishing it. On the other hand Matsumoto Jun (29) and Ninomiya Kazunari (30) covered the local fire brigade which has been training locals as firefighters in the riverside of the city. The 2 member also engaged in this activity while sporting the fire brigade's uniform.
hno shared his impressions after interacting with the victims, "The road of recovery continues, we felt part of this big force but after experiencing fishing tangle together our thoughts are now stronger than before". Ninomiya who interacted with them while training as a firefighter talked about the lesson learned, "The human connection or rather, feeling this strong sense of responsibility towards the younger generations".
During the live, in addition to the 550 fans of three prefectures affected, they also invited the firefighters and the families who trained them in fishing tangle. Since the venue was too narrow, they could easily reach the hands of the audience while performing their latest song, "Endless Game" and "Happiness" among other hit songs. Aiba excitedly commented, "Really really close! I felt a little embarrassed at some parts, but I think we all became one". Matsumoto talked about the future, "I'm really glad we all had the opportunity to come and meet you directly and even make you feel a little happier. We would like to continue delivering energy to Japan in the future".
